Natalya Vladimirovna Linichuk (Russian: Наталья Владимировна Линичукⓘ; born 6 February 1956) is a Russian ice dancing coach and former competitive ice dancer for the Soviet Union. With partner and husband Gennadi Karponosov, she is the 1980 Olympic champion and a two-time World champion.
